Improving Transportation Efficiency

Optimizing transportation involves a multifaceted approach that considers various factors, including route selection, vehicle utilization, and driver efficiency. Careful route planning can significantly impact transportation times and costs. Utilizing advanced route optimization software can identify the most efficient routes based on real-time traffic conditions and other relevant variables, leading to substantial savings.

Maximizing vehicle utilization is another key aspect of improving transportation efficiency. Fleet management systems can track vehicle performance, predict maintenance needs, and optimize scheduling to minimize downtime and maximize uptime. This proactive approach not only reduces costs but also enhances overall operational reliability.

Managing Warehousing and Inventory

Efficient warehousing and inventory management are integral to optimized logistics and transport. Strategic warehouse layout and efficient material handling systems are crucial for minimizing handling time and maximizing storage capacity. Proper inventory management techniques, such as just-in-time inventory systems, can reduce storage costs and minimize the risk of stockouts.

Implementing automated systems for inventory tracking and management can enhance accuracy and reduce errors. This automated approach also allows for better forecasting of demand and optimal inventory levels, thereby minimizing storage costs and maximizing profitability.

Streamlined Workflow Processes

Data integration often leads to streamlined workflow processes. Automated workflows, triggered by specific data events, can significantly improve efficiency and reduce manual effort. For instance, an automated approval process triggered by a completed task in a project management system can expedite decision-making and ensure that projects move forward smoothly. This automation reduces bottlenecks and allows teams to focus on higher-value tasks.
